This Select Reserve from 2014 is crafted for taste from hand selected casks.  A limited release of 2964 bottles at natural cask strength.

Distillery Location
Clynelish - Select Reserve (2014 Release) Cask Strength's home is Distillery Location distillery, in the Highland region of Scotland.

Clynelish Distillery is a distillery near Brora, Sutherland in the Highlands of Scotland.

The original distillery was built in 1819 , adjacent to the new Clynelish. The original Clynelish closed in the year 1967 as the new Clynelish distillery had been built. The old distillery was renamed Brora Distillery and production of a peated spirit continued until 1983.

Pronunciation : "kline-leesh"
